Sohini Bose (MPhil in International Relations) is a Research Assistant at Observer Research Foundation (ORF) Kolkata, working on Phase II of the project — India’s Maritime Connectivity: Importance of the Bay of Bengal — under the ‘Proximity to Connectivity' research programme. Her latest publications are an Issue Brief entitled In the eye of tempestuous Bay of Bengal: Measuring the disaster resilience of major ports on India’s east coast (ORF: New Delhi, 2019, co-authored), a book chapter in Adluri Subramanyam Raju (ed.) Blue Economy of India: Emerging Trends (Studera Press: 2019, co-authored) and a Report on ‘India’s Maritime Connectivity: Importance of the Bay of Bengal’ (ORF: Kolkata, 2018, co-authored).
